      We should check the overhead of running $currentOp, which needs to access data that are wrapped in atomics.

      One way to do this would be to adapt an existing test with a task that executes $currentOp at a reasonable frequency (once a second or so). We can coordinate with the team that is developing Mongotune to understand what a reasonable frequency might be.

      For SPM-3716, we should not have more than a 1% impact on performance.
